Green Shirts
16 items
Filter by
- New
Lightweight Regular Fit Tropical Short Sleeve Shirt
£100.00+ More Colours
- -20%
Washed Pure Linen Shirt
£90.00 £72.00+ More Colours
- -20%
Washed Pure Linen Shirt
£90.00 £72.00+ More Colours
Regular Fit Pure Linen Shirt
£100.00+ More Colours
- -20%
TH Flex Regular Short Sleeve Shirt
£65.00 £52.00+ More Colours
- New
Regular Fit Stripe Oxford Shirt
£85.00+ More Colours
- New
TH Flex Regular Fit Stripe Shirt
£90.00+ More Colours
Regular Fit Oxford Shirt
£85.00+ More Colours
TH Flex Stripe Poplin Shirt
£75.00+ More Colours
- -18%
Check Slim Fit Oxford Shirt
£51.00 £42.00+ More Colours
- New
TH Flex Regular Fit Poplin Shirt
£75.00+ More Colours
- New
Slim Fit Poplin Shirt
£65.00+ More Colours
- -20%
TH Flex Regular Fit Poplin Shirt
£75.00 £60.00+ More Colours
- -18%
Brushed Check Regular Fit Shirt
£51.00 £42.00+ More Colours
- -18%
Tartan Check Regular Fit Poplin Shirt
£45.00 £37.00+ More Colours
- -18%
Micro Gingham Poplin Slim Shirt
£45.00 £37.00+ More Colours